Shift4 Payments’ (NYSE:FOUR) CEO Jared Isaacman cancelled an appearance at a Wolfe fintech conference this week due to a scheduling conflict. Shift4 (FOUR) shares seesawed in Monday morning trading amid the report.
Shift4’s (FOUR) investor relations will present as scheduled at the Wolfe Research FinTech Forum this week, a Shift4 representative confirmed to Seeking Alpha in an email.
The update comes as Reuters reported late last month that FiServe (FI) was competing to purchase the company. FiServe is one of the main conteders for Shif4 (FOUR). FOUR has been running a sales process and final offers are expected to be made in the coming weeks, Reuters reported at the time.
FiServe (FI) is still scheduled to present at the Wolfe conference on Thursday.
Shift4 Payments (FOUR) confirmed in its Q3 shareholder letter that it was “actively exploring strategic opporunities and alternatives.”
